To the incoming director and the finance team: we are mid-transition from Kestrel Freight Solutions to Brindlehaven Logistics. Contracts with Kestrel terminate at quarter-end; Brindlehaven onboarding is roughly 70% complete. Please note the revised invoicing cadence (fortnightly) and the holdback clause covering transit damage claims. Pallet reconciliation for the Dunmarsh warehouse remains outstanding and needs closing before final settlement. The confidential planning note below sets out the strategic rationale for this switch.

board note of baweg-bawig: Project Tamath slips by six weeks because of the audit delay.

Runbook: GarageGlance occupancy feed

If the Harborview Deck occupancy feed goes stale (no updates for 5+ minutes), first check the sensor gateway health page. Green but stale usually means the aggregator queue is backed up; restart the aggregator via the ops console and counts should recover within two minutes. If spots show negative numbers, force a full recount from the camera snapshots. When escalating to engineering, include the trace token shown below.

session token of yawif-kahof = htk9_dd6996ed6

CI Troubleshooting: Catalog Cache Invalidation

Plugin authors targeting the Fernwick Catalog API should note that CI builds occasionally fail when stale category caches persist between pipeline stages. The runner reuses the warm cache volume unless your plugin manifest bumps its schema version, so price and SKU fixtures may reflect the previous run. Clear the volume explicitly in your pre-test hook if fixtures drift. When reporting a failure, always include the token printed below.

session token of kageg-tahop = htk14_af3c1ccccb7dcf